Australia spy agency moves intelligence data to cloud in Amazon deal
Australia will move its top secret intelligence data to the cloud under a A$2 billion deal with Amazon Web Services that Defence Minister Richard Marles said would boost defence force interoperability with the United States. The Director General of the Australian Signals Directorate, Rachel ...
